THQ

The inexpensive and robust desk top high voltage power supplies are assembled out of the proven high voltage modules of the CPS, DPS and EPS series. The units are available with either 1, 2 or 3 high voltage channels in many variations and combinations.
The output voltage is controlled via the 10-turn potentiometer, the USB interface or the analog I/O. Output voltage and current is displayed on a 2 line LCD per channel, located on the front panel.

1-channel and 2-channel versions with:

  • high voltage modules CPS series 500 V up to 10 kV / max. 12 W output power or
  • high voltage modules DPS series 500 V up to 6 kV / max. 12 W output power, with switchable polarity, very low ripple and noise and very high stability

1-channel versions with:

  • high voltage modules CPS series 15 kV up to 30 kV / max. 12 W output power or
  • high voltage modules EPS series 500 V up to 10 kV / max. 60 W output power

1-channel up to 3-channel in 2U-19” versions with:

  • high voltage modules CPS, DPS and EPS series up to 30 kV in arbitrary combinations

For more technical data see the description of the according modules.

The HV modules (DC/DC converter) are supplied with AC/DC-converter:

  • up to 24 W output power with a wide range AC mains supply (100 to 240 V AC) and
  • for more output power with a switchable AC mains supply (110 V AC / 230 V AC ).

Solid-state detectors

Particle Detectors based on semiconductive materials, such as Silicon-, Germanium- and Cadmium zinc telluride-detectors and Silicon Photomultipliers are used for the proof and measurement of ionizing radiation. Depending on design and application of the detector, high voltage power supplies with high stability, low noise and specific protective features are necessary. iseg staff has a longstanding experience in design and manufacturing of high voltage power supplies for semiconductive particle detectors and is offering standard products as well as customer specific supplies.

gas ionisation detectors

Gas ionisation detectors, such as Ionisation Chambers, Straw-Tubes, Wire Chambers, Resisitive Plate Chambers, Gas Electron Multipliers, MicroMegas and more are widely used in different applications for the detection of ionising radiation. For proper operation these detectors often need reliable high voltage power supplies with very high stability and low noise. Depending on detector type, specific protection to prevent damage of the detector can also be necessary. iseg has longstanding experiences with various detector types and a wide product range from single channel devices to systems with several thousands of channels.

Avalanche photo diodes

Avalanche Photo-Diodes (APD) are used for detection of very small doses of light or radiation with in some cases very high frequencies. Dependent on Design and application APDs can also be used for single photon counting. APDs are used in various fields in Science and Industry, such as Biology, Medicine, Chemistry, Aviation and more. iseg offers a wide range of power supplies with high stability and low noise in small packaging.

Ion Implantation

Ion Implantation is used for insertion of Ions into specific materials (doping) to achieve a specific change of the characteristics of the basic material. This method often used in the semiconductor industry. Several steps of this method (i.e. Acceleration, Separation of Ions, Deflection of Ions) require high voltage power supplies.
